Restaurant Gary Danko at the San Francisco Fisherman’s Wharf is one of the best restaurants in San Francisco to have richly deserved the Mobile Five-Star award. The namesake Gary Danko’s central theme is theatrical art that is both seamless and magical from the best performers in the restaurant industry for both the efficient back-end kitchen and the polished front-end dining room. The view of the San Francisco Fisherman’s Wharf with the romantic Golden Gate Bridge and the Pacific Ocean beyond is as breathtaking as the cuisine is stunning.
San Francisco Gary Danko Executive Chef Gary Danko’s interpretation of California cuisine spotlights on traditional ingredients such as meats, poultry and foie gras with a supporting cast of seasonal fruits and vegetables such as cherries in the spring, tomatoes in the summer and figs in the fall.
